Easy Peanut Butter Energy Balls

Easy Peanut Butter Energy Balls

Easy Peanut Butter Energy Balls are a no-bake, quick, and nutritious snack perfect for busy days, offering a healthy boost of energy without any fuss. This recipe is incredibly useful for anyone needing a simple, satisfying, and delicious grab-and-go option.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 0 minutes
Chill Time 20 minutes
Total Time 10 minutes
Servings: 12 balls
Course: Dessert, Snack

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up rolled oats
  • 1/2 cup peanut butter creamy or crunchy, your preference!
  • 1/3 cup honey or maple syrup
  • 1/4 cup chopped chocolate chips mini or regular
  • 1/4 cup ground flaxseed
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• pinch salt if your peanut butter is unsalted (optional)

Equipment

  • Mixing bowl
  • Spatula
  • Airtight container

Method
 

  1. In a medium-sized mixing bowl, add the rolled oats and the ground flaxseed. Stir them together to ensure they are evenly distributed.
    1 cup rolled oats, 1/4 cup ground flaxseed
  2. To the bowl with the oats and flaxseed, add the peanut butter, honey (or maple syrup, if using for a dairy-free option), and vanilla extract. If you are using unsalted peanut butter and prefer a slightly more pronounced flavor, add a small pinch of salt at this stage.
    1/2 cup peanut butter, 1/3 cup honey or maple syrup, 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ract, pinch salt
  3. Using a sturdy spoon or a spatula, begin to mix all the ingredients together. It might seem a bit dry at first, but keep mixing! The goal is to incorporate all the dry ingredients into the wet ones until a thick, cohesive dough forms. Patience is key here; you want everything well combined.
  4. Once the dough is mostly mixed, gently fold in the chopped chocolate chips. Mix just enough to distribute them evenly throughout the dough. Avoid overmixing at this stage to keep the chocolate chips from becoming too broken down.
    1/4 cup chopped chocolate chips
  5. For easier rolling, you can cover the bowl with plastic wrap and place it in the refrigerator for about 15-20 minutes. This allows the peanut butter to firm up slightly, making the dough less sticky and easier to handle.
  6. Once the dough is ready, take about a tablespoon of the mixture at a time and roll it between your palms to form small, compact balls, roughly 1-inch in diameter. If the mixture is still a little too sticky, you can wet your hands slightly with water or lightly grease them with a bit of coconut oil.
  7. Your Easy Peanut Butter Energy Balls are ready to be enjoyed immediately! You can place them on a plate or in an airtight container.

Notes

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week. For longer storage, freeze for up to 2-3 months.
